Get started29 Piper Drive is a three-bedroom detached house in Long Whatton, Loughborough, Loughborough (LE12 5DJ). It has a recorded floor area of 159 m² (around 1711 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(December 2025)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band. When first surveyed in November 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Poor to Average, window ef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 82). This certificate was lodged in the last six months, so the rating reflects current condition.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 6.9%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£425,000 is 39.3% above the 2019 sale price. At 159 m² the property is well over the postcode median (109 m² across 15 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 87% of similar EPCs). Most recent transfer: September 2019 at £305,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2020.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
